摘要
The distributions of N-methyl-d-aspartate (NMDA), α-amino-3-hydroxy-S-methyl-4-isoxazole propionic acid (AMPA) and kainic acid (KA) receptors were determined in the human cerebellum using autoradiography. In contrast to the cerebral cortex, where KA receptors have a complementary distribution to NMDA and AMPA receptors, AMPA receptors were concentrated in the cerebellar molecular layer while NMDA and KA receptors were concentrated in the granular layer. © 1990.
